Unfortunately, the work is not just fun. Because of all the mess that he encounters in the sea, driving sometimes wonders: “What are we actually doing?” But driving remains positive. “I draw a lot of hope when I see how much life there is in the shipwrecks, a wreck is actually an oasis of life.”

As an example, he tells about old fishing nets, which not only ensure that animals become entangled, but is also a place where they can lay eggs. Oasis of life or not, ship’s waste still causes a lot of animal suffering and that is why driving continues. “If we make our North Sea a little cleaner, then the animal life becomes more beautiful and ours,” he concludes.
